Most of the world (except the US, Liberia and a few other small countries) has gone metric, actually decimal! The metric system is decimal-based, as is our currency, and provides a simple progression from stage to stage (e.g., centimeter to meter to decameter/dekameter to hectometer to kilometer, etc.;  also gram to dekagram to hectogram to kilogram, etc.). It’s a pity we remain addicted to the old British and irregular system (e.g., inches to feet to yards to miles, etc.; also ounces to pounds to tons, etc.). ****

This race attempts to engage the metric system in the distance markers for a race. The 5K will have distance markers at 1K, 2K, 3K, and 4K (with the 5K the same as the finish). For comfort and familiarity, there also will be the mile markers at 1M, 2M and 3M. The fun run will be 1K rather than 1 Mile. ****
